Understanding the Results

Estimated Monthly Subsidy

This is the amount of financial assistance that may help reduce monthly insurance costs.

Higher subsidy amounts generally result in lower out-of-pocket premiums.


Estimated Net Premium

This is the monthly premium remaining after subtracting the estimated subsidy.

Formula:

Net Premium = Monthly Premium โˆ’ Monthly Subsidy


Annual Subsidy

The annual subsidy shows how much financial assistance may be received over an entire year.

Formula:

Annual Subsidy = Monthly Subsidy ร— 12

This figure helps users understand total yearly savings.
